Decoding Sound: The Role of DACs
A DAC, which stands for Digital-to-Analog Converter, is a surprisingly important piece of equipment in today's digital world. Most of our music is stored as digital files, like MP3s or FLACs, which are just numbers. A DAC takes those numbers and turns them into the electrical signals that your amplifier and speakers need to make sound. A Nod to Audio History: California Audio Labs
Speaking of DACs and digital audio, who remembers California Audio Labs? Cal, as it was often called, certainly made a big splash in the early days of digital audio. They were among the first companies to really push the boundaries of what digital sound could be, offering high-quality CD players and DACs when digital was still finding its footing. Essential Audio File Management
First things first, you need to make sure that your audio file is in a supported format. Different players and devices can handle different types of files, so checking that is a good starting point. Then, you should always check the audio file location. If your audio file is stored on an external drive or network location, make sure that it is accessible. Sometimes, a simple disconnect can cause all sorts of headaches. Keeping your files organized and easily reachable prevents a lot of frustration, and it's just a good habit to get into for any digital media, really.

What is audio science?
Audio science is the study of sound, how it's produced, how it travels, and how we perceive it. It involves physics, engineering, and even a bit of psychology, all aimed at understanding and improving sound reproduction and recording. It's basically the deep dive into why things sound the way they do, and how to make them sound even better.
How do audiophiles evaluate speakers?
Audiophiles evaluate speakers using a mix of listening tests and technical measurements. They listen for things like clarity, bass response, soundstage (how wide and deep the sound appears), and how natural voices and instruments sound. They also look at measurements like frequency response, distortion, and impedance, which provide objective data on how a speaker performs.
